Top Rated Apache ActiveMQ Alternatives

The queue management tool is too good and helps me to communicate among 43 microservices which I developed for one of my clients. It's very fast and convenient to use. Review collected by and hosted on G2.com.
Compared to Kafka it is not that much robust and fast to process messages. But As it is opensource and easy to available and setup, I have used it and fulfilled my requirements Review collected by and hosted on G2.com.
15 out of 16 Total Reviews for Apache ActiveMQ

The best thing about ActiveMQ is it's easy to integrate with java JMS, and its scaling feature is phenomenal; it can handle significant loads and high availability and is easy to solve Review collected by and hosted on G2.com.
The worst thing about ActiveMQ is that it is not applicable for high loads, and its documentation is not highly readable; it is not appropriate for event streaming. Review collected by and hosted on G2.com.

-> I have used it when I need queueing support in my application. Although I am new at that time, it is easy to understand, and simple UI manage my things.
-> It is open source, so anyone can use it without paying a penny.
-> It Supports many messaging protocols like MQTT, STOMP, AMQP, TCP, SSL, etc.
-> This messaging broker I have used with Java and REST API, so it is accessible to implements and having a good amount of resources available to take help if you are stuck. Review collected by and hosted on G2.com.
-> I didn't much use of this software as I started using apache Kafka, rabitMQ, but I can say that apache ActiveMQ is simpler than Kafka as Kafka have more features.
-> Sometimes you face delays in message delivery, or sometimes it's failed delivery, so no assurance of delivery. Review collected by and hosted on G2.com.

Apache ActiveMQ has been a solid workhorse for JMS Message Broker services at our company. We especially like the delayed send feature, something which we don't have when we use Kafka. Review collected by and hosted on G2.com.
Unfortunately, Apache ActiveMQ doesn't cluster nicely, so if the broker goes down, there is not a seamless failover to a secondary broker, without losing data. There are some published hacks to work around this, but it is not baked into the product's DNA like other message broker implementations. Review collected by and hosted on G2.com.
A perfect solution for comunicate systems with diferents technologies.
You can enqueue requests without overload your main system.
You can adminintrate it with a web interface. Review collected by and hosted on G2.com.
If you have problems, documentation is very poor and it is not very popular. It’s difficult find people that know this software. Operation is similar to other queuing system for easy tasks. Review collected by and hosted on G2.com.
Best thing i like with Apache Active MQ that it supports spring framework. Apache Active MQ is open source. It is a simple and perfect solution to communicate systems with different technologies. Apache Active MQ also provide features like message load balancing and master slave configuration. Review collected by and hosted on G2.com.
There is nothing i dislike with Apache Active mq and it is totally open source. Review collected by and hosted on G2.com.
It's stable and has been there for quite sometime now. Review collected by and hosted on G2.com.
It's has become legacy and more alternate managed services are available in many cloud providers Review collected by and hosted on G2.com.

It supports multiple languages such as Java, C, C++ , Perl , Python, PHP , C# , Ruby, etc. It has many advanced features such as Composite Destinations, Virtual Destinations, Message Groups, Wildcards. It has Spring framework support as well. Supports multiple transportation protocol such as NIO, UDP, multicast, TCP, SSL, JGroups. I work on java, and from my experience I can say that it is very easy to use. We can use this for parallel processing also. Review collected by and hosted on G2.com.
Nothing as such. Everything in ActiveMQ is easy to develop. Review collected by and hosted on G2.com.
I love the ease of use for Apache ActiveMQ. We use this service remotely with many of our customers. For instance, we will have them on the phone and we will have to tell them how to access their queues, and this product is perfect for using remotely. We never feel like it would be easier for the customer if we were in person with them when using this product Review collected by and hosted on G2.com.
I think that something that could be updated is a user guide about the difference between deleting and purging queues right on the queues page. This is something that always trips me up, and I wish there were a question mark I could hover over or click on for quick clarification without actually leaving the page I am on. Review collected by and hosted on G2.com.

Connection templates that comes with the bundle are pretty useful.
In case you're someone structured and want to create DEV, TEST and PRODUCTION environments in the same box with different ports, the procedure actually works.
It comes with several protocols and you can choose the one you feel more comfortable.
Admin interface is basic but within time intuitive, you can check all messages stuck and reprocess in case you want to. Review collected by and hosted on G2.com.
In a year we had to restart the queues 3 times in Production environment as a java memory leak affected us and we couldn't identify what the problem was, so we did the restart thing. Review collected by and hosted on G2.com.

I learn tech things pretty quickly but was unfamiliar with Apache. What I really liked is that I could google how to do things under this program incredibly easy. Review collected by and hosted on G2.com.
What I disliked about this program is that there could be features that would make it more user-friendly for those that do not use apache as much. Review collected by and hosted on G2.com.